Eh, it's not so bad for foreigners. First, they won't worry about it much because I'm posting in English, not Chinese. 2nd, it's on a foreign discussion board, (as far as I know) no mainlanders read it. Third, typically they just scare foreigners into silence, or worst case for the political die-hards they just kick them out.

*shrug*

There's some advantages to being a foreigner working in China... as opposed to say... a local born journalist posting through Yahoo.
